Alec Baldwin Instagram post spurs Anthem BCBS to cover Virginia teacher’s spine surgery

Anthem Blue Cross Blue Shield said it would cover most of the cost of a Virginia music teacher’s spine surgery and treatment following an Instagram post from actor Alec Baldwin, the Augusta Free Press reported July 6. 

Advertisement

Ryan Featherer is the orchestral director at Maury High School in Norfolk, Va. He suffers from multiple sclerosis and needed a spinal cord stimulator to relieve his pain and continue teaching.

The stimulator device from Medtronic was deemed medically unnecessary, and out-of-pocket costs for the surgery were $50,000, so a GoFundMe page and local fundraising campaign were launched.

A mother of one of Mr. Featherer’s former students contacted Mr. Baldwin, who hosts the New York Philharmonic’s radio broadcasts.

Mr. Baldwin posted on Instagram June 9 to highlight the situation and fundraising efforts.

On June 20, Anthem told Mr. Featherer it would cover most of the cost of surgery and the Medtronic implant, according to the GoFundMe page. There are still some out-of-pocket costs, but the fundraiser has received over $25,000 as of July 7. The surgery is now scheduled for later this month.
